NFC (Near Field Communication) is short-range wireless communication technology. It is a non-contact identification and interconnection technology that can conduct short-range wireless communication between mobile devices, consumer electronics and other devices.
To put it simply: nfc is a short-distance communication function of mobile phones, and the nfc sensing area is an area that can trigger NFC communication. The proximity of sensing areas will result in establishing a connection or starting an application, allowing further operations.
The NFC sensor on the mobile phone is generally not available in low-end mobile phones. The sensor of mobile phones equipped with NFC function is usually on the back of the mobile phone close to the camera. On the surface, It is generally invisible because it is blocked by the mobile phone, but it does not affect the use of the sensor.
The sensor in contact with the mobile phone is also the sensing area that determines what functions to activate. Generally, there is an obvious NFC logo. Common scenarios include riding, payment, access control cards, and allowing the mobile phone to quickly launch applications, etc. .
Features of Huawei nfc
1. NFC mobile payment
When it comes to mobile payment, the first thing most of us think of is WeChat payment or Alipay. In fact, through the NFC function, we can also realize mobile payment. For example, Huawei Wallet realizes mobile payment through the NFC function.
Huawei mobile phones can read bank card data to bind bank cards through NFC. Then, when you need to pay, you only need to touch the mobile phone to swipe the card POS machine to complete the payment. Compared with WeChat and Alipay's scan code payment is much faster.
2. NFC bus card
When we go to work every day, most of us either take the bus or the subway. At this time, we all use the bus Card. However, it is a bit inconvenient to carry a physical bus card, and sometimes it is forgotten at home. The NFC bus card just solves this problem. After activating the NFC bus card on the mobile phone, we only need to tap the mobile phone with the card swiping machine of the bus or subway to complete the swiping of the card to board the bus.
3. NFC access card
Many communities and companies, in order to facilitate travel, have begun to use access cards. Only through the access card can you swipe the card to enter the community. and company doors. However, carrying an access card with you is easy to lose and inconvenient.
At this time, mobile phone NFC access control cards came into being. We can read the data of the access control card to the mobile phone through the NFC function of the mobile phone. Then, the mobile phone becomes a virtual access control card. We only You only need to touch your mobile phone to the card machine at the gate to open the gate, which is more convenient than a real access card.
4. NFC car key
This function is quite cool. You can unlock the vehicle and open the door through your mobile phone. At present, only some domestic BYD models support the mobile phone NFC car key function. We only need to put the mobile phone close to the part where the car signal receiver is located to successfully unlock the vehicle.
Moreover, the mobile phone can be operated without being connected to the Internet. The car can be unlocked regardless of whether the mobile phone has power or is turned off or on. In this way, car enthusiasts no longer need to carry a remote control or Key chain.
5. NFC one-touch transfer
One-touch transfer, as the name suggests, is file data transfer. This is also a major strength of the NFC function. NFC transmission The speed is much faster than traditional Bluetooth transmission.
This function is fully reflected in Huawei smart terminals. For example: two Huawei mobile phones turn on the NFC switch and only need to touch it to input files; the Huawei mobile phone only needs to touch the NFC of Huawei laptop area, you can quickly transfer files to your computer.
6. NFC one-touch connection
In the past, if we wanted to connect two smart devices, we basically did it through Bluetooth or WIFI. Connection, such as: connecting to smart Bluetooth speakers, connecting to smart routers to manage routers, etc.
If both smart devices and mobile phones support the NFC function, connecting them through NFC will become more convenient and faster. We only need to touch the smart device with our mobile phone to quickly connect them.
7. NFC electronic ID card
The NFC function of the mobile phone can also read the data of the ID card, quickly enter the identity information into the mobile phone, and turn it into an electronic ID card.
Although electronic ID cards are still in the trial stage, and are currently only in trial operation in some areas. For example, the electronic ID card of Huawei mobile phones can be used as an ID card in some hotels in Shenzhen, but this is also the future. A big trend.
